oldglory wrote:Listen up.. It may be hard to swallow but dont worry about that kind of shit. Just worry about 1 step at a time, ie passing basic training and doing the best you can.
That's a very good point. When you get sent to your squad, your number one task is to shut your mouth and show your Team Leader and Squad Leader that you're not a slug. The first thing that you are going to have to prove to them is that you are deserving to be there in the first place. The attrition rate for Privates in a ranger battalion is much higher than it is for ranger students in ranger school. In a lot of ways, life in a ranger batt as a private is much more difficult than life in ranger school. ranger school sucks, but in a different way. If you get to go there some day, you'll understand what I'm talking about.

rangermatt wrote:In a lot of ways, life in a ranger batt as a private is much more difficult than life in ranger school. ranger school sucks, but in a different way. If you get to go there some day, you'll understand what I'm talking about.
I would say that the largest difference is that in Ranger School, there is a target date that marks the end of the suckfest. With being in Bn, there is not target date that ends and it is different than suffering - it is more like the constant pressure to push no less than 100% effort at everything you do.
